29.92 inches of Mercury, which is the average atmospheric pressure on Earth at sea level, is about 14.7 pounds per square inch.

150 mm Hg is the same as 2.90 PSI: 1 atmosphere == 760 mm Hg, so 150 mm Hg is the same as 0.197 atm. 1 atmosphere = 14.696 PSI so (0.197)(14.696) = 2.90 PSI
